The Senior Accounting Manager is responsible for overseeing the accounting, accounts receivable, accounts payable and payroll functions.
Essential Functions- Demonstrate and promote Opaa!’s Core Values of “Act in the Best Interest of the students, schools and communities we serve, Be honest in everything we do, Have a passion to serve others, Commit to continuous improvement”.
- Managing the daily, weekly and monthly transactional flow for Accounts Receivable, Accounts Payable, Fixed Assets, and the General Ledger month end close process.
- Supervise and support the Accounting Specialists (AR/AP) in the completion of their job responsibilities.
- Manage daily and monthly cash flow.
- Manage the timely and accurate processing of all vendor invoices and employee expense reports including ensuring appropriate approvals have been obtained; invoices are coded to the proper G/L account; proper controls are maintained over disbursement checks.
- Manage the timely and accurate processing of customer billings, ensuring the customer is invoiced correctly for all services and products supplied by Opaa! in accordance with the terms of the district contract.
- Ensure the timely collection of Accounts Receivable.
- Ensure the accuracy of the balance sheet and income statement accounts with generally accepted accounting principles.
- Supervise the month end general ledger closing process.
- Maintain accurate fixed asset records.
- Monitor and work with districts to ensure that inventory counting and general accounting policies are being adhered to.
- Prepare and review monthly journal entries and balance sheet account reconciliations for month end closing.
- Review and reconcile payroll and benefits bi-weekly.
- Assist in the review and analysis of the monthly financial statements.
- Prepare miscellaneous analysis and reconciliations as requested by management team.
- Assist with all aspects of financial and 401K audits to ensure the auditors receive all requested information.
- Work with the Benefits Administrator on benefit reconciliation.
- Provide exceptional customer service and support to Opaa! employees in the field as needed.
- Maintain focus on continuous improvement and solutions by recommending process improvements to senior management.
- Create and maintain export files from BOSS to Great Plains.
- Coordinate data integrations between systems to maximize efficiency.
- Additional duties as assigned.

Bachelor Degree in Accounting or equivalent work experience; CPA, a plus but not required.
Experience- 1 - 3 years’ experience in managing a team
- Over five years of experience in full cycle accounting role
- Strong analytical, problem-solving, and multi-tasking, and organizational skills.
- Problem-solving, process improvement.
- Strong follow-up skills.
- Demonstrated teamwork skills.
- Strong ability to integrate and communicate effectively, orally and in writing, with all levels of the organization. Able to write business correspondence and memos.
- Strong financial analysis skills with attention to detail.
- In-depth understanding of financial statements and cost accounting metrics.
- Ability to identify trends and drivers of financial results.
- In-depth understanding of MS Excel, proficiency in other Office applications.
- Basic understanding of accounting software and report builders.
- Knowledge of Great Plains, a plus
- Must be able to appropriately handle confidential information.
- Must be able to travel, as required (est. 5%-10%)
